2009-05-07 9 views
0

Ich verwende Combobox, die drei Wert enthält - NSW, TIC, VIA. Beim Laden der Seite setze ich selectedindex = 1 für den combobx, der als TIC angezeigte Wert ist korrekt, wird aber nicht hervorgehoben. Ich kann sehen, dass wenn der Benutzer einen anderen Wert auswählt (ich meine, der Index erhält eine Änderung für die Combobox von der UI), dann wird der bestimmte Text hervorgehoben, aber es passiert nicht, wenn wir den Index progammatisch ändern (C# -Code). ComboboxStyle ist DropDown. Kann mir irgendjemand sagen, dass das der Grund sein könnte?Text wird nicht hervorgehoben in Combobox, wenn selectedindex durch Code geändert wurde

Antwort

0

Die Combobox erhält den Fokus nicht, nachdem der ausgewählte Index festgelegt wurde. Stellen Sie den Fokus mit der Focus() -Methode ein.

0

Stellen Sie sicher, dass die Combobox Tabstop-Eigenschaft auf True festgelegt ist. Andernfalls werden Sie die Auswahl nicht sehen.

Verwandte Themen